Samuel explained to Liza that he would be doing a big job for the Trasks, digging wells and constructing windmills. She scoffed at the idea even though he explained that it was a chance for him to make good money. When they finished breakfast, Tom and Samuel went outside to begin preparations for the Trask job. Joe said he wanted to help, but Samuel said his mother would not let him. He suggested that Joe should tell his mother that Samuel was firmly set against his helping on the job, implying that she would probably let him go if it was in opposition to her husband’s wishes. Two days later, Joe was with Samuel and Tom as they headed for the Trask place.
This chapter highlights the domestic life of the Hamiltons and further endears Samuel to the reader as he interacts with his wife and sons. Liza Hamilton, though a strict and demanding woman, is still portrayed as a good person with the best interests of her family at heart. She scolds her husband for being late to breakfast and staying out too late the night before. When she questions Samuel about Cathy Trask, she immediately decides that she is not fit company and suggests that Samuel does not visit the Trasks again because of their riches and idleness. Samuel, however, has committed to work on the Trask place, digging wells and building windmills. In spite of his negative feelings about Cathy, he is delighted to have a chance to earn some good money and eagerly makes preparations for the work. He also tricks Liza into letting Joe accompany him and Tom on the job.
